Democrat Mark Kelly has won a US Senate seat for Arizona, beating out Republican Martha McSally for the seat once held by the late Senator John McCain, who died in August 2018.

“Tonight is not about celebrating, tonight is about getting to work,” Kelly told a small crowd in Tucson earlier in the evening.

Kelly spoke about the hardships Arizonans have faced owing to the ongoing coronavirus pandemic, saying that that many small businesses are in peril in the southwest state.

“They need a lifeline right now,” he said.

The Democrat leader said he would strive for policies to set back Trump’s crackdown on immigration, lowering healthcare costs and the need to “rebuild the economy – and it’s going to be a massive undertaking”.

A centrist Democrat and former astronaut, Kelly first opened a large lead over McSally as the vote counting got under way in the southwest state.

McSally became US Senator when Republican Governor Doug Ducey appointed her to the seat. She had previously lost a Senate bid to Democrat Kyrsten Sinema.
